Hotel Description

Umi To Sora Ishigaki Island

Umi To Sora Ishigaki Island is a serene and inviting hotel located at 1216-211 Kabira, Ishigaki, Okinawa 907-0453, Japan, offering an unforgettable getaway for those seeking natural beauty and cultural immersion. Nestled in a tranquil area surrounded by lush greenery and pristine beaches, this hotel boasts a calm atmosphere that complements the island's scenic allure. The rooms at Umi To Sora are thoughtfully designed, each featuring comfortable kitchenettes, allowing guests to prepare their own meals if they wish. With air-conditioned rooms and high-speed Wi-Fi, guests can enjoy both comfort and convenience throughout their stay. The hotel is located just a short drive away from famous attractions like Kabira Bay (7 minutes) and Yonehara Beach (3 minutes), both offering breathtaking views and excellent opportunities for outdoor activities. Guests can easily explore local culture with visits to places like Ishigaki Yaima Village (17 minutes) or venture further to Taketomi Island (2 hours 36 minutes). For those interested in dining, Umi To Sora is ideally positioned near various restaurants such as Carib Cafe (2 minutes away) and 米原食堂 Kitchen Younehara (3 minutes away), offering a variety of delectable local and international dishes. Public transportation is easily accessible, with taxis providing quick access to New Ishigaki Airport (20 minutes) and local bus terminals within walking distance. The hotel is family-friendly, offering amenities such as beach access, parking, and air conditioning, ensuring a comfortable stay for all. Though it does not feature a fitness center, pool, or spa, it remains a perfect retreat for those looking to relax and explore the natural wonders of Ishigaki Island. Cover Image for Hitomi Yokoyama

Hitomi Yokoyama

5/5
I used it with 6 people from 3 generations: my parents, myself, and my children.I was able to arrive with peace of mind as I was able to receive smooth replies from the manager via email regarding bed placement, check-in times, etc.The parking lot was very spacious, and even with a large rental car that I wasn't used to, I was able to turn around easily. However, the path leading to the parking lot is narrow, so you need to be careful, especially at night as it is pitch dark.The view from the living room is amazing.As of March, the previous building was in the middle of construction, so I was a little worried about construction workers coming and going, but I don't think it would be a problem to see the exterior once it's completed.It's quiet at night and you can only hear the chirping of insects. I was finally able to see a starry sky in the middle of the night on the last day. There were so many stars that I couldn't make out the constellations, and I even saw a few shooting stars.When I was looking at the stars, my son said that the ground was also glowing, and when I looked, I saw that the grassy side of the parking lot was glowing in spots. Is it a firefly larva or something? There were small insects among the gravel in the parking lot, and they were shining in countless numbers. It was very beautiful.From a housewife's perspective, the amenities and kitchen equipment are sufficient.It was especially helpful to have a gas dryer. The clothes I wore that day would dry the same day, which saved me from having to do a lot of laundry after returning from a trip.My son said that the most memorable thing about his trip to Ishigaki Island was the inn, and both his parents and children were very satisfied with the inn.

Cover Image for やまがら

やまがら

5/5
Thank you for taking care of my family.Yoshi Yaeyama, Soba-san, and Tommy's bakery are nearby. The wooden building in the large garden that could easily accommodate 10 cars was very nice. When you open the electronic key and enter through the wide entrance, you will be amazed by the ocean view from the living room, dining room, and terrace! When you look through the window, it looks like a painting! The thick pillars are visible and the ceiling is high, giving it a nice sense of openness.The room has two beds on either side of the living room and dining room, and when you go up the stairs there is a loft-like bed on the second floor, as well as a terrace. There is a handrail along the right wall of the stairs, but there is nothing on the left side, so it does not interfere with the open feeling of the living room and dining room, but please be careful when drinking alcohol or using it with children. There is a robot vacuum cleaner in each room, but I was surprised that it started working in the middle of the night, so I turned it off.The sanitary room is very spacious and there is also a washing machine and dryer, so you can reduce your luggage. The toilet, bath, and sink are separate. There are two small round bowl type wash basins. I don't like the small bowl type, but I guess this type is popular now. Well, I guess it can't be helped around here.The sink in the kitchen is deep, but it seems a little small, and the stove is IH, hot plate, electric kettle, and toaster? We have a microwave oven and everything else you need. I guess the seasonings are just a bonus. I bought some Yaeyama soba and used the sauce from the yakiniku I bought at Yuratik to make yakisoba using Misaki beef. It was delicious. This is my favorite in Ishigaki.The dust box where you can separate garbage was convenient. I get the impression that most of the furniture and items are from IKEA. For those who enjoy cooking, it would be better to have both the size of the pot and, if you prefer, Japanese and Western tableware.The scenery is great, and I think you can enjoy it with your family as Maibara Beach, Kabira Bay, and Sukuji Beach are nearby.
